             Subpart 32.2_Commercial Item Purchase Financing

 

Sec. 32.201  Statutory authority.



    10 U.S.C. 2307(f) and 41 U.S.C. 255(f) provide that payment for 

commercial items may be made under such terms and conditions as the head 

of the agency determines are appropriate or customary in the commercial 

marketplace and are in the best interest of the United States.
